Historical & Cultural Background

The name Kanessa is believed to have roots in the combination of the name "Kane" and the suffix "-essa," which is often used in feminine names. The name "Kane" has origins in various cultures, including Irish and Hebrew.

In Irish, it is derived from the Gaelic name "O'Cathain," meaning "descendant of Cathan," with Cathan meaning "battle." In Hebrew, the name Kane is associated with the word "qanah," meaning "to acquire" or "to create." The suffix "-essa" is derived from Latin, where it was used to form feminine nouns, and it has been adopted in various languages to denote femininity in names, particularly in Romance languages. U.S. Historical Usage

The name Kanessa was first seen in the United States in 1979.

Kanessa has ranked as high as #12074 nationally, which occurred in 1980, and has been most popular in .

In the past 5 years the name Kanessa has been trending up compared to the previous 5 years.
